What is Secondary Glazing?
Secondary glazing involves the installation of an extra pane of glass or acrylic to existing windows. This develops an insulating air gap that assists minimize heat loss and noise infiltration. Unlike traditional double glazing, which has two sheets of glass, secondary glazing can be added to single-pane windows, allowing homeowners to enhance their existing windows without total replacement.
How Secondary Glazing Works
Secondary glazing develops a barrier in between the interior and exterior environments. The essential systems at work include:
- Insulation: The air space in between the panes forms an insulating layer, substantially reducing heat transfer through conduction.
- Minimized Thermal Bridging: Secondary glazing lessens the transfer of heat through the window frames, ensuring more stable indoor temperatures.
- Sound Dampening: The additional layer also functions as a sound barrier, lowering noise pollution from outside.
Efficiency of Secondary Glazing
To better comprehend the efficiency of secondary glazing, let's look at some measurable elements and compare them to traditional single-glazed windows.
| Factor | Single Glazing | Secondary Glazing | Double Glazing |
|---|---|---|---|
| U-Value (W/m ² K) | 5.0 - 6.0 | 1.5 - 2.0 | 1.0 - 1.4 |
| Sound Reduction (dB) | 25 - 30 | 30 - 45 | 35 - 45 |
| Installation Cost | Low | Medium | High |
| Return on Investment | N/A | 5-10 years | 10-20 years |
The table above highlights the numerous aspects of main glazing systems. Significantly, secondary glazing significantly improves the U-value, which determines thermal insulation-- the lower the U-value, the much better the insulation.
Advantages of Secondary Glazing
- Energy Efficiency: Secondary glazing boosts thermal insulation, resulting in lowered heating & cooling expenses.
- Cost-Effectiveness: Compared to complete window replacements, secondary glazing is a more affordable path to improving energy efficiency.
- Noise Reduction: Particularly advantageous for homes in urban environments, secondary glazing provides significant sound proofing.
- Historical Preservation: Perfect for noted structures or duration homes where initial windows should be kept, secondary glazing provides a discreet method to enhance performance.
- Easy Installation: Generally, secondary glazing can be fitted without comprehensive changes, making it a less invasive option compared to changing entire windows.
Disadvantages of Secondary Glazing
- Condensation Issues: Without appropriate ventilation, the air space might collect condensation, potentially leading to mold issues.
- Less Effective for Extreme Climates: In really cold or hot environments, secondary glazing alone may not suffice without extra insulation procedures.
- Appearance: Depending on the design and materials utilized, secondary glazing can modify the aesthetic of windows, which may not be preferable for all house owners.
How to Achieve Maximum Efficiency with Secondary Glazing
To enhance the benefits of secondary glazing, think about the following tips:
- Choose High-Quality Materials: Opt for low-emissivity glass or acrylic, which reflects heat and increases thermal efficiency.
- Guarantee Proper Sealing: Installing your secondary glazing with high-quality seals is vital to preventing air leakage.
- Regular Maintenance: Clean and examine seals frequently to guarantee optimal efficiency and longevity.
- Consider Window Treatments: Complement secondary glazing with curtains or thermal blinds for added insulation.
Frequently Asked Question About Secondary Glazing Efficiency
1. Just how much does secondary glazing cost?Secondary glazing expenses vary depending upon the materials used and the complexity of installation. Usually, property owners might expect to spend between ₤ 300 to ₤ 600 per window.
2. Is secondary glazing efficient for noise reduction?Yes, secondary glazing can significantly reduce noise transmission, making it ideal for homes found near hectic roadways or in loud urban areas.
3. Can secondary glazing be used on any window?Most of the times, secondary glazing can be adapted to different window styles. However, it's constantly best to speak with a professional installer for customized recommendations.
4. Does secondary glazing require preparation approval?Specific regulations can vary based on local laws and the age of the residential or commercial property. If you live in a noted building or sanctuary, you might require to talk to your local planning authority.
